当前位置:   article > 正文

从0到1使用NodeJS编写后端接口的实战案例(仅供参考)_node开发后端接口

node开发后端接口

目录

一、项目简介

1、使用技术

2、实现的主要功能

3、项目结构

二、开发环境准备

1、安装node.js

2、安装 MYSQL 数据库

3、安装 node.js 的 mysql 驱动

4、安装 Express 框架

5、Node 格式化时间模块Silly-datetime

6、安装 nodemon 

三、后端代码

1、入口文件 — index.js

2、数据库连接配置文件 —— db.js

3、api路由配置文件 —— myApi.js

四、各模块功能的后端代码

1、用户注册和登录退出

2、修改用户信息

3、用户头像上传和更新

4、用户密码的修改

5、商品列表的查看和搜索

6、商品详情查看

7、添加商品和商品图片上传

8、商品评论的查看和添加

9、购物车列表

10、添加、删除购物车

11、用户商品收藏列表

12、用户商品的收藏和取消

13、用户的添加商品列表

14、用户的添加商品的删除

五、前端代码

1、配置文件(主要是后端接口请求地址要配置代理)

2、package.json

六、运行项目

1、前端代码运行命令(参考vue项目)

2、后端代码启动命令

七、静态文件

八、文件上传

九、multer

1、安装

2、使用

3、文件信息

4、Multer(options)

.single(fieldname)

.array(fieldname[, maxCount])

.fields(fields)

.none()

.any()

5、Storage

磁盘存储引擎 (DiskStorage)

内存存储引擎 (MemoryStorage)

6、limits

7、fileFilter

8、错误处理机制

参考文档


一、项目简介

基于vue和node.js来开发的一个在线商城管理系统。

1、使用技术

前端:使用vue框架搭建开发

后端:使用Node.js来编写开发

数据库:Mysql

开发工具:VSCode、navicat premium

2、实现的主要功能

用户注册和登录退出

修改用户信息

用户头像上传和更新

用户密码的修改

商品列表的查看和搜索

商品详情查看

添加商品和商品图片上传</

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/小小林熬夜学编程/article/detail/118908
推荐阅读
相关标签
  

闽ICP备14008679号